Discount Brokerage Department Manager jobs in Torrance, CA

Discount Brokerage Department Manager manages and leads a group of discount brokers responsible for the purchase and sale of securities for clients at discounted commissions. Develops marketing programs and strategies to increase profitability and enter new markets. Being a Discount Brokerage Department Manager monitors transactions for accuracy and ensures satisfactory customer service. May interact with the organization's full-service brokers as needed. Additionally, Discount Brokerage Department Manager ensures compliance with any applicable regulations. Requires a bachelor's degree in a related area. Requires NASD Series 7 license. Typically reports to a director. The Discount Brokerage Department Manager typ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Discount Brokerage Department Manager typ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    SUMMARY

    The Account Manager, Freight Brokerage is a key operational role for the DSV Road Inc. freight brokerage branches. They are responsible for ensuring and providing timely workflow tools and information including pricing approvals, negotiating with transportation providers to obtain the best rates and services, and troubleshooting any issues that may be escalated to them by the Carrier Sales team members. They are responsible for managing the branch’s house accounts, while continuously seeking out additional growth opportunities with clients.


    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Negotiates with transportation carriers and providers to obtain, set rates and determine services available.
    • Measures and monitors carrier’s service levels to ensure benchmarking is tracked within the VFT (Visual Freight Tracking) system.
    • Provides direction and sets pricing guidelines for Carrier Sales team.
    • Researches and determines growth opportunities within the branch’s house accounts.
    • Prepares and distributes “load-build” reports for customers and carriers.
    • Works directly with customers on the receipt and processing of transportation requirement requests.
    • Assists in the training of Carrier Sales team members.
    • Acts as a next level reviewer for troubleshooting errors and/or issues.
    • Proactively handles customer shipment routing requests.
    • Utilizes various transportation software systems to facilitate material movement, planning, and scheduling.
    • Tracks and traces shipments from pickup through delivery to ensure accurate and up-to-date shipment information is being provided to customers.
    • Ensures customer expectations are met or exceeded by completing accurate and timely scheduling/dispatching of trucks and rail cars.
    • Other duties and project work as assigned by manager

Torrance is a coastal community in southwestern Los Angeles County sharing the climate and geographical features common to the Greater Los Angeles area. Its boundaries are: Redondo Beach Boulevard and the cities of Lawndale and Gardena to the north; Western Avenue and the Harbor Gateway neighborhood of Los Angeles to the east; the Palos Verdes Hills with the cities of Lomita, Rolling Hills Estates and Palos Verdes Estates on the south; and the Pacific Ocean and city of Redondo Beach to the west. It is about 20 miles (32 km) southwest of Downtown Los Angeles. Torrance Beach lies between Redondo...
